Anti-evolution

The term 'anti-evolution' refers to a belief system or ideological stance that opposes or rejects the scientific theory of evolution, which posits that species change over time through natural selection and genetic mutation. Anti-evolutionary perspectives often arise from various religious, philosophical, or cultural viewpoints that assert creationist narratives or argue against the implications of evolutionary theory. This stance often influences educational policies and public debates surrounding science curricula.
